Output 654a70d3f489da5757c0acdddc21b7821d4856e68d0fc1b2a6521095a21ea986:115

value
133954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c83fe74770eabb3f85b836e2a61d2c50a4ad534a OP_EQUAL
address
3KwqczrQY76D2RThhgY3UpHfEWGpfGJs3R
transaction
654a70d3f489da5757c0acdddc21b7821d4856e68d0fc1b2a6521095a21ea986
spent
true